Sept. 23: Painted Book Boxes for Adults at Newhall Library

Let creativity shine with a Painted Book Box event Monday, Sept. 23, 10-11 a.m. at Old Town Newhall Library, 24500 Main St, Santa Clarita, CA 91321. In this adults-only event, the wooden book boxes can be painted as a favorite book cover, a unique and new creative design or anything else that the creative...

Aug. 28: Youth Grove Evening of Remembrance

The annual Evening of Remembrance will take place on Wednesday, Aug. 28 at 7:15 p.m., in the Santa Clarita Youth Grove at Central Park in Saugus. The event begins with the Walk of Remembrance, where participants walk together in solidarity, offering support and solace to the families who have lost loved...
